Rajdarshan Industries Limited (ARENTERP) has a Working Capital to Net Assets ratio of 23.9% as of September 2025. Working capital of Rs54.23 Million (current assets of Rs57.37 Million minus current liabilities of Rs3.14 Million) is measured against net assets of Rs227.35 Million. A higher ratio indicates strong short-term liquidity financed by the equity base. See Rajdarshan Industries Limited balance sheet quality to measure how much of total assets are equity-financed.
